2. FHA

The Federal Housing Administration (FHA) stands for a government agency in the United States that offers housing insurance to FHA-approved lenders who follow certain conditions.

Here's how mortgage loan specialists use fha:
  • Specialized to underwrite all investors such as Freddie Mac, FHA insured, VA, Private and HFI ad MAP loans.
  • Cross Selling of bank products * Processed and closed conventional, FHA and VA home loans as well as Rural Development.

6. Credit Reports

Credit reports are statements that carry information about your credit affairs and current credit situation like loan payment history and credit accounts status. A credit report acts as history because it contains the record from the day you opened the account till your account balance. Potential lenders and creditors make use of credit reports and decide whether to offer you credit or not and under what conditions.

Here's how mortgage loan specialists use credit reports:
  • Ordered finished proof credit reports, review for accuracy and transfer information accordingly.
  • Remain knowledgeable of credit reports and underwriting analysis.
